Toyota Motor Philippines is indeed pushing for the new Tamaraw to be the king of versatility for business owners with plenty of body conversions to choose from. But this time, it looks like TMP is opening up the possibility of offering the Tamaraw for public transportation.
The Land Transportation Office (LTO) has released the homologation documents for a certain Toyota Hilux Tamaraw PUV Class 1. Based on the information, the Tamaraw PUV Class 1 will make use of the long wheelbase version and will be powered by a 2.4-liter turbodiesel engine with a 5-speed manual transmission.
As mandated by PUV Class 1 regulations from LTFRB, we should expect the Tamaraw PUV to have right-side exit doors instead of rear swing-out doors found in the utility van version. According to the LTO document, the Tamaraw PUV Class 1 has a seating capacity of 12 passengers including the driver.
Should Toyota Motor Philippines push through with offering the PUV version of the Tamaraw, that gives transport cooperatives more options to choose from as the PUV Class 1 segment already includes the likes of the Isuzu Traviz, Mitsubishi L300, and the Hyundai H-100.
